Abstract
The present invention relates to a transmission apparatus for an electric vehicle or a hybrid vehicle. More particularly, the present invention relates to a motor transmission apparatus which has a plurality of electric motors, driving gears connected to the electric motors, and slave gears, to drive the front or rear wheels of the vehicle independently from one another. The present invention also relates to a hybrid vehicle using the motor transmission apparatus. The present invention discloses a motor transmission apparatus for a vehicle which is constituted by two or more electric motors connected to a battery, driving gears connected to the respective motor shafts of the electric motors, and slave gears engaged with the driving gears to drive either the front wheels or the rear wheels of the vehicle.
